Hotel Overview
Our Boutique Family Hotel provides 25 rooms of different types; double rooms, twin rooms and suites. All the rooms are equipped with the most modern amenities, satellite TV, mini-bar, AC/ heating, safety box – Approximately 50% of the rooms have sea view and 50 % park view.

- Area description
- Situated in Gradac directly on the beach. The Hotel got its name from the famous explorer Marco Polo who was born under this blue Dalmatian sky, not far from Gradac on the Green Island of Korcula. The History and old traditions are also preserved throughout the hotel as well as in our brand. The story one will experience here is a gentle blend between the authentic Dalmatia – Marco Polo’s birth place and the orient he discovered.
